What is a based learning coordinator?

A Based Learning Coordinator is an education professional responsible for organizing and managing learning programs that emphasize experiential, project-based, or work-based learning. They collaborate with teachers, students, and external partners to ensure meaningful, hands-on educational experiences. Their duties often include planning curriculum, facilitating partnerships with businesses or community organizations, and assessing student progress. The goal is to connect classroom learning with real-world applications to better prepare students for future careers.

How does a based learning coordinator typically collaborate with faculty and external partners to enhance experiential learning opportunities for students?

A Based Learning Coordinator regularly works with faculty to design, implement, and evaluate experiential learning programs, such as internships, community projects, or service-learning initiatives. They serve as a liaison between the institution and external partners, developing relationships with organizations to secure meaningful placement opportunities for students. Effective coordinators facilitate clear communication, set expectations, and provide ongoing support to both students and partners, ensuring that learning objectives are met and experiences are mutually beneficial. This collaboration often involves organizing training sessions, conducting site visits, and collecting feedback to continuously improve program quality.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a based learning coordinator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Work-Based Learning Coordinator, you need a background in education or career counseling, strong organizational skills, and often a relevant bachelor’s degree or teaching license. Familiarity with student information systems, career assessment tools, and basic office software is typically required. Excellent communication, relationship-building, and problem-solving abilities help in connecting students with appropriate work-based learning opportunities and collaborating with employers. These skills ensure effective coordination of programs that bridge classroom learning with real-world work experiences for student success.

What is the difference between Based Learning Coordinator vs Curriculum Specialist?

AspectBased Learning CoordinatorCurriculum Specialist
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, teaching certification often preferredBachelor's or master's degree in education or related field, teaching certification beneficial
Work EnvironmentSchools, educational programs, online learning platformsSchools, districts, educational publishers, government agencies
Employer & Industry UsageEducational institutions focusing on personalized or project-based learningCurriculum development and instructional design in education sector

Based Learning Coordinators focus on implementing and managing personalized learning programs within educational settings, often working directly with students and teachers. Curriculum Specialists concentrate on designing, developing, and refining curricula to improve instructional quality. While both roles require educational credentials and work in similar environments, the Coordinator emphasizes program management, whereas the Specialist emphasizes curriculum development.

About the Program: Care Coordination

Care Coordination at CHR is an intensive program for children and youth ages 0-18 (or up to age 22 if in school) with emotional/behavioral difficulties and complex service needs and their families. Care Coordinators assist the family through a child-specific team that develops individual and family-focused service plans. The coordinators also provide ongoing consultation with the child-specific team to provide linkage, coordination, follow-up, and advocacy for the child and family.
